How do you find initial velocity?

  1. Work out which of the displacement (S), final velocity (V), acceleration (A) and time (T) you have to solve for initial velocity (U).
  2. If you have V, A and T, use U = V – AT.
  3. If you have S, V and T, use U = 2(S/T) – V.
  4. If you have S, V and A, use U = SQRT(V2 – 2AS).

What is an example of initial velocity?

For example, if a projectile is moving upwards with a velocity of 39.2 m/s at 0 seconds, then its velocity will be 29.4 m/s after 1 second, 19.6 m/s after 2 seconds, 9.8 m/s after 3 seconds, and 0 m/s after 4 seconds.

What are the 3 formulas for velocity?

The three equations are,

  • v = u + at.
  • v² = u² + 2as.
  • s = ut + ½at²

How do you find final and initial velocity?

Final velocity (v) of an object equals initial velocity (u) of that object plus acceleration (a) of the object times the elapsed time (t) from u to v.

Is initial velocity usually 0?

If a car starts from rest, its initial velocity is zero. If a projectile is tossed into the space, its initial velocity will be more than zero. If a car stops after applying the brake, the initial velocity will be more than zero, but the final velocity will be zero.

Is velocity Initial always 0?

The initial velocity is only taken zero when a body starts from rest. Initial velocity can be non-zero also. Initial velocity taken as 0 when the object is at rest and it will start to move that is the state of object just before to move.

How do you solve for final velocity?

Final Velocity Formula vf=vi+aΔt. For a given initial velocity of an object, you can multiply the acceleration due to a force by the time the force is applied and add it to the initial velocity to get the final velocity.

What is the initial velocity of a reaction?

The initial linear rate of product formation is called the initial velocity, or vo. It is one of the most important characteristics of any enzyme-catalyzed reaction. One factor that affects the initial velocity is the substrate concentration, [S].
